  • Publication number: 20140294165
    Abstract: A teleconferencing system for voice and data provides interconnections among user sites via a central station. User stations at user sites each alternate operation between a data mode connecting a user computer and modem to a user telephone communication path and a voice mode connecting a telephony circuit to the communication path. The teleconferencing system is adapted for conducting a voice conference over standard telephone lines while allowing simultaneous viewing of data objects such as slides, graphs, or text. A host computer connected to the central station serves as a central repository for storage and retrieval of data objects for use in teleconferences.

  • Publication number: 20100001838
    Abstract: Techniques for associating assets of a medical care facility include receiving a first data flow that indicates a first unique identifier for a first radio frequency identification (RFID) tag and receiving a second data flow that indicates a second unique identifier for a second RFID tag. Also received is database data that associates the first unique identifier with a first asset and associates the second unique identifier with a different second asset. It is determined whether a position of the first RFID tag is within operative distance of a position of the second RFID tag based on the first data flow and the second data flow and the associated first asset and second asset. If it is determined that the position of the first RFID tag is within operative distance of the position of the second RFID tag, then the first asset is automatically associated with the second asset.

  • Publication number: 20060089539
    Abstract: Techniques for integrating messages from a medical care devices used to monitor or treat a patient include receiving association data. The association data indicates an association between a particular patient and one portable communication device assigned to one primary medical caregiver. The association data also indicates multiple associations between the patient and corresponding medical data generators. A medical data generator provides medical data to support an alert that indicates attention is desired from a medical caregiver. The medical data generators direct their data to diverse destinations. If an alert is issued based on any of the medical data generators, the portable communication device is determined based on the alert and the association data, a caregiver message is generated based on the alert, and the caregiver message is sent to the portable communication device. These techniques allow alerts from multiple medical devices to be integrated onto a single portable communication device.

  • Patent number: 5845195
    Abstract: The present invention relates to a wireless apparatus for transferring information between computers. The communication device uses a diskette that transmits and receives information by using radio frequency. The diskette includes receiving and transmitting circuitry which is used in conjunction with software to facilitate the file transfer.

  • Patent number: 5338937
    Abstract: A radiation imaging device of the type employing a scintillator and a position-sensitive photomultiplier tube eliminates or reduces edge effects and thereby increases the linear field of view by compensating for nonlinearities which distort an image close to the edge. Specifically, (1) a light guide is placed about the edge of the scintillator to channel light that would otherwise be reflected from the edge of scintillator to a light absorbing material so that edge reflected light is not detected by the position-sensitive photomultiplier tube and (2) variable resistors are employed to compensate for distortions in the image caused by current leakage along the edge of the position-sensitive photomultiplier tube.
